Transaction 106cfb7417f3722bb158167f9356739d69a31466f1a86a2919cbebaf7e876caa

1 Input
2 Outputs
  • 106cfb7417f3722bb158167f9356739d69a31466f1a86a2919cbebaf7e876caa:0
  • value  417802
    address  1J5XnAsTPkSo4UrSkFA3gWeGVgGZMB7AiE
  • 106cfb7417f3722bb158167f9356739d69a31466f1a86a2919cbebaf7e876caa:1
  • value  6000000
    address  1MYn8336NsSusy759AWADWFWs2hkwgn8oj